Error 1020 access denied while using my own wordpress site

I keep getting error 1020 access denied on my own site while in the WordPress dashboard. I try to update a few plugins and receive the error. What should I do? I found out I need to do something with the site rule but I have no idea what to do. I even get “error establishing a database connection” error because of this and have to keep restarting my host to get the site back up.

If you get a 1020, you should take a look at the Firewall Events Log for your domain at dash.cloudflare.com

You can filter by IP address, so yours should bring something up. Clicking on the entry will show you the Cloudflare setting that’s blocking access.